Output fba77f2f021ae36545a967344e49c1400abf23b88e3da600d3120371f8258bf7:0

value
1404012544
script pubkey
OP_0 OP_PUSHBYTES_20 ecb68691825de27fde61ce8b16d38ff94f0c9a14
address
bc1qajmgdyvzth38lhnpe693d5u0l98sexs5e3du7f
transaction
fba77f2f021ae36545a967344e49c1400abf23b88e3da600d3120371f8258bf7
spent
true